I Didn't Support Anand's Decision - Vijay Devarakonda
By: Tupaki Desk | 8 July 2019 12:23 AM ISTVijay Devarakonda broke into tears talking at Dorasani pre-release event. He talked about his brother, Anand Devarakonda and said that he couldn't be for him during his starting days.
He said, "My little brother used to follow me everywhere. He was so attached to me that he wouldn't go even to his classroom for days. I was in 4th standard then and he was in 1st.
He studied Engineering, struggled to go to USA, got a job in Deloitte kind of a big company. Looking at my success, I thought he wanted to stay with me.
I thought he might have felt lonely and he is coming back. I did not appreciate those decisions but accepted them, still.
One day, he said that he will act and brought a script to me. I told him, acting is not a joke and did not even talk to him for whole film. Many thought I am behind his debut but I did not even want to come to the event without watching the film.
I wanted to help him, I wanted to help the team, I wanted to help Shivatmika too. But I did not understand if they have it in them to toil hard and make a film, make it as actors.
I am amazed as I saw the film on 6th July. I am amazed by Director Mahendra, I am amazed by the grit these kids showed in taking all the trolling and those hardships made them strong. I really felt a magic in the film and that will make it a success for sure.
When my little brother sent us money from USA, it helped me not be the bread earner and follow my dreams (tearing up)... I feel I should've been there for him from the start but I am glad that he did not need me until the film is finished and today, I am promoting a good film I liked but not my brother!"
Dorasani is the debut film of Shivatmika Rajasekhar, Anand Devarakonda directed by Mahendra, releasing on 12th July.
